Transaction 45f319323c51747ae16cd12a261db08bab42c15c26aa932e52a62e652c971f16
1 Input
2 Outputs
- 45f319323c51747ae16cd12a261db08bab42c15c26aa932e52a62e652c971f16:0
- 45f319323c51747ae16cd12a261db08bab42c15c26aa932e52a62e652c971f16:1
value 626822000
address 18cPZXrZe373mvKdRiUXWQPERd4P97PbC3
value 152014844
address 1339SgzGtH74Ni8GrkZNzxHkU7Rus7T1zH